Ashlee Simpson-Wentz and Pete Wentz married last year, but now they're coming out in support of their gay friends and fans who can't do the same. The couple shot a campaign in support of gay marriage for "NOH8." In the shot, the two are featured posing together with "NOH8" written on their cheeks and duct tape over their mouths, while Simpson-Wentz held a wedding veil.

The shots were taken by photographer Adam Bouska on Monday. Bouska launched NOH8 with his partner, Jeff Parshley, after Proposition 8 passed in California in November.

Also involved in the shoot was Blink 182's Mark Hoppus, who will also have his own shots. Hoppus, along with the Wentz's, was involved in human rights protests following the decision on Prop 8.

"My son asked me one time, 'Some guys have girlfriends and some girls have boyfriends, but do boys sometimes have boyfriends?' " Hoppus told E! at the rally. "I said, 'Yeah, all kinds of people love different kinds of people. And that's the world we live in.' "
